Business Analyst | Banking Operations | Contract

NewBe an early applicant

About the Role


We are seeking an experienced Business Analyst to support a key transformation initiative within Private and Retail Banking Operations. The successful candidate will work closely with business stakeholders, project teams, and risk/compliance functions to drive change initiatives from project initiation through implementation and closure.

Key Responsibilities

  • Support end-to-end project delivery for Private and Retail Banking Operations transformation initiatives.
  • Elicit, analyse, and document business requirements related to entity consolidation, operating model changes, and migration activities.
  • Perform current-state and target-state process mapping, including controls, hand-offs, roles, responsibilities, and management information reporting.
  • Identify process gaps and support the design of effective business solutions.
  • Develop and maintain project plans, milestones, dependencies, and critical paths to ensure timely delivery.
  • Manage RAID logs (Risks, Assumptions, Issues, and Dependencies) and support change control processes through appropriate governance channels.
  • Collaborate with Risk and Compliance teams to ensure requirements meet MAS regulations and internal control standards, including audit trails and segregation of duties.
  • Define, coordinate, and support User Acceptance Testing (UAT), cutover planning, and change readiness activities across people, processes, data, and systems.
  • Facilitate stakeholder discussions, drive decision-making, and provide regular project updates to senior management.


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or equivalent.
  • With 3-5 proven experience as a Business Analyst and/or Project Manager within complex transformation programmes, preferably in the banking or financial services industry.
  • Expertise in business requirements gathering, process analysis, process modelling, and stakeholder management.
  • Experience working on regulatory, risk, and control-driven initiatives within financial services environments.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to engage and influence stakeholders across all levels.
  •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and documentation capabilities.
  • Demonstrated ability to manage multiple priorities and deliver results in fast-paced environments.
  • Good presentation and report-writing skills, with experience preparing materials for senior management and governance forums.
  • Exposure to migrations, legal entity consolidation, operating model redesign, or large-scale change programmes would be advantageous.
  • Good understanding of Private Banking operations and processes
  • Experience within Private Banking, Wealth Management, or Retail Banking operations.
  • Familiarity with MAS regulatory requirements and banking control frameworks.
  • Experience supporting UAT, migration, and change management activities within banking transformation projects.
